自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Code for fun !!! 【博客主要为本人服务】

CSDN只是用来存储个人已完成的markdown笔记,平时逛掘金比较多。感谢小伙伴在CSDN看到我的笔记,如有错误恳请指正,欢迎小伙伴一起讨论技术。

  • 博客(52)
  • 收藏
  • 关注

原创 【笔记】【Javascript】javascript实现继承

子类拥有父类的特征和行为特征==属性行为==方法。

2023-05-30 23:37:14 385

原创 【笔记】【Javascript】浅面了解原型和原型链

属性,指向原型对象的原型对象,以此类推直到指到最顶层找不到则返回null。属性,这个属性也指向他的原型对象,原型对象也是对象,也有。如下图最底下连成的线为原型链。属性形成的链式结构成为原型链。由一个一个对象,一层一层。

2023-05-22 22:58:09 382

原创 【笔记】【编程范式】浅度了解面向对象编程

面向对象编程——Object Oriented Programming,简称OOP,是一种。隐藏对象的属性和实现细节,仅对外公开接口,控制在程序中属性的读取和修改的访问级别。

2023-05-18 15:07:41 414

原创 【笔记】【Javascript】闭包

链式作用域:子对象会一级一级地向上寻找所有父对象的变量。所以,父对象的所有变量,对子对象都是可见的,反之则不成立。【示例】1. 获取到函数内部的局部变量(f2函数获取到f1函数的变量)【示例】2. 让变量不会在外部函数调用后被自动清除。闭包就是能够读取其他函数。

2023-05-17 07:54:38 182

原创 【计网】【TCP】浅析TCP三次握手

之前学习计网时不认真,TCP三次握手稀里糊涂就过去了,最近在重新查漏补缺计网这方面的知识,饭要一口一口吃,我就没有把其中涉及到的大量知识点写在此博客中,此文仅管中窥豹,之后再详细写吧。

2023-05-16 23:26:06 309

原创 【笔记】【HTTP】《图解HTTP》第7章 确保web安全的https

即使请求或响应的内容遭到篡改,也没有办法获悉。(即没有任何办法确认,发出的请求/响应和接收到的请求/响应是前后相同的。窃听位置:[TCP/IP](# 2. 确保可靠性的TCP协议)是可能被窃听的网络。TSL是以SSL为原型开发的协议,有时候会统一称该协议为SSL。产生原因:HTTP本身不具备加密功能,所以无法做到对。下载的文件是否就是原来服务器上的文件。产生原因:HTTP协议中的请求和响应。应用层协议通信,即发送HTTP响应。产生的隐患:接收到的内容可能有误。服务器:可进行SSL通信时,会以。

2023-05-09 09:38:04 68

原创 【笔记】【HTTP】《图解HTTP》第5章 与HTTP协做的Web服务器

(即待代理转发从服务器返回响应时,代理服务器将会保存一份资源副本。不改变请求 URI, 会直接发送给前方持有资源的目标服务器。代理服务器或客户端本地磁盘内保存的资源副本。(服务器和浏览器的“中间人”)转发其他服务器通信数据的。能使通信线路上的服务器。好处:提高通信的安全性。

2023-05-09 09:34:44 109

原创 【笔记】【HTTP】《图解HTTP》第3章 HTTP报文内的HTTP信息

当浏览器的默认语言为英语或中文,访问相同 URI 的 Web 页面时, 则会显示对应的英语版或中文版的 Web 页面。使用场景:状态码 206(Partial Content,部分内容)响应报文包含了多个范围的内容时。使用[多部分对象集合](# 2. 多部分对象集合)方法,来容纳多份不同类型的数据。客户端和服务器端就响应的资源内容进行交涉,然后提供给客户端最为适合的资源。指明应用在实体内容上的编码格式,并保持实体信息原样压缩。以响应资源的语言、字符集、编码方式等作为判断的基准。及响应报文首部的结构。

2023-05-09 09:31:50 123

原创 【笔记】【HTTP】《图解HTTP》第2章 简单的HTTP协议

虽然是无状态协议,但为了实现期望的保持状态功能,于是引入了[Cookie技术](# 2.8 使用Cookie的状态管理)。在两台计算机之间使用 HTTP 协议通信时, 在一条通信线路上必定有一端是客户端, 另一端则是服务器。在大量资源加载请求时,每次的请求都会造成无所谓的TCP连接建立和断开,【通信出现的问题】——每进行一次HTTP通信就要断开一次TCP连接。实现:建立1次TCP连接后进行多次请求和响应的交互。多个请求,而不需要一个接一个地等待响应了。,则保持TCP连接状态。来控制客户端的状态。

2023-05-09 09:29:22 367

原创 【笔记】【HTTP】《图解HTTP》第1章 了解Web及网络基础

计算机与网络设备要相互通信,双方就必须基于相同的方法。比如,如何探测到通信目标、由哪一边先发起通信、使用哪种语言进行通信、怎样结束通信等规则都需要事先确定。不同的硬件、操作系统之间的通信,所有的这一切都需要一种规则。[协议](#2. 协议:)中存在各式各样的内容从电缆的规格到 IP 地址的选定方法、寻找异地用户的方法、双方建立通信的顺序,以及 Web 页面显示需要处理的步骤,等等。TCP/IP 协议族按层次分别分为以下 4 层:应用层、传输层、网络层和数据链路层。:对上层应用层,提供处于网络连接中的。

2023-05-09 09:27:46 414

原创 【LeetCode】【学习笔记】64. 最小路径和

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-15 23:17:11 77

原创 【LeetCode】【学习笔记】238. 除自身以外数组的乘积

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:47:36 66

原创 【LeetCode】【学习笔记】312. 戳气球

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:32:52 62

原创 【LeetCode】【学习笔记】406. 根据身高重建队列

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:31:56 65

原创 【LeetCode】【学习笔记】739. 每日温度

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:30:25 261

原创 【LeetCode】【学习笔记】105. 从前序与中序遍历序列构造二叉树

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:28:55 77

原创 【LeetCode】【学习笔记】234-回文链表

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:27:40 89

原创 【LeetCode】【学习笔记】169多数元素

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:26:52 46

原创 【LeetCode】【学习笔记】160. 相交链表

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:25:19 69

原创 【LeetCode】【学习笔记】141. 环形链表

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-14 23:24:08 59

原创 【LeetCode】【学习笔记】206.反转链表

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-06 16:11:20 122

原创 【LeetCode】【学习笔记】48. 旋转图像

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-06 16:03:53 79

原创 【LeetCode】【学习笔记】121. 买卖股票的最佳时机

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-06 16:02:47 44

原创 【LeetCode】【学习笔记】101. 对称二叉树

个人算法学习笔记(可能涉及) 1、个人做题思考、做题方法 2、全网对本人有效的学习资源 3、别人的做题方法(感谢链接中的各位大神)

2022-12-06 10:47:43 166

原创 【MySQL】【报错码】1273 - Unknown collation: ‘utf8mb4_0900_ai_ci‘

【报错码】1273 - Unknown collation: 'utf8mb4_0900_ai_ci‘处理方法

2022-12-06 10:43:37 360

原创 【MySQL】【报错码】1406-Data too long for column

【报错码】1406-Data too long for column处理方法

2022-12-06 10:41:03 755

原创 【LeetCode】【学习笔记】136. 只出现一次的数字

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-06 09:53:30 196

原创 【LeetCode】【学习笔记】39.组合总和

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-06 09:46:45 44

原创 【LeetCode】【学习笔记】538. 把二叉搜索树转换为累加树

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-06 09:45:18 39

原创 【LeetCode】【学习笔记】104. 二叉树的最大深度

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-06 09:11:10 110

原创 【LeetCode】【学习笔记】22. 括号生成

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:46:38 66

原创 【LeetCode】【学习笔记】78. 子集

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:42:29 49

原创 【LeetCode】【学习笔记】617. 合并二叉树

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:36:43 38

原创 【LeetCode】【学习笔记】543. 二叉树的直径

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:35:06 64

原创 【LeetCode】【学习笔记】46. 全排列

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:32:53 57

原创 【LeetCode】【学习笔记】338. 比特位计数

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:25:58 48

原创 【LeetCode】【学习笔记】94. 二叉树的中序遍历

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:22:51 96

原创 【LeetCode】【学习笔记】70. 爬楼梯

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:05:47 45

原创 【LeetCode】【学习笔记】461. 汉明距离

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 22:00:52 85

原创 【LeetCode】【学习笔记】1.两数之和

个人算法学习笔记(可能涉及)1、个人做题思考、做题方法2、全网对本人有效的学习资源3、别人的做题方法

2022-12-05 21:56:30 65

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除